* WINDS…Southwest 20 to 30 mph with gusts up to 45 mph.
* RELATIVE HUMIDITY…As low as 8 percent.
* TEMPERATURES…Up to 96.
* IMPACTS…Any fires that develop will likely spread rapidly.
Outdoor burning is not recommended.
* SEVERITY…
FUELS (ERC)…70th-89th percentile…4 (out of 5).
WEATHER…Extreme…4 (out of 5).
FIRE ENVIRONMENT…8 (out of 10).
